    I really liked the first version of these routers so when we moved into a bigger house, I was really excited to add these to our setup… Unfortunately, they are really lacking on features and the setup was an absolute pain because the software was too simple. When something went wrong, it showed no errors or trouble shooting, you just had to start all over. Plus, they are NOT compatible with the old ones, so you have to buy an entirely new set, and the access points don’t have an Ethernet plug for your wired machines, so you’re forced to buy all routers if you need a port. After much frustration and headache, I returned all of these and bought a gaming router which turned out to be a much simpler setup.

      Hi ryancleve2, we appreciate you for sharing the details of your experience with using the Nest Wifi. We’re sorry to learn that they always have weak signals and run slow at times, and that you can only set a priority device for 8 hours at a time.

      The placements of your Wi-Fi router and points are vital to have reliable Wi-Fi throughout your home. As a general rule, points work best when they’re no more than two rooms away from each other. For example, if the far end of your house has weak Wi-Fi, don’t put a Wifi point in that exact spot. Instead, put it part way in that direction. Try to place it in an elevated position like on a shelf.

      It may be helpful to try the following steps to see if the Wi-Fi performance will improve:
      - Move the connected device closer to your Wifi router or point.
      - Repositioning the points to avoid obstructions like walls, doors, and aquariums can improve performance.
      - Make sure all unused devices are off and not draining bandwidth with large downloads.
      - Check for possible sources of interference such as microwave ovens, refrigerators or other equipment.
      - Run a mesh test to confirm placement of your Wifi points.
